This article will guide you in exporting data out of BoivSync to be imported into Hoof Supervisor.

Due or Past Due Hoof Trimmings Chore Report

This report contains all animals that have a 'Trim' or 'Hoof Maintenance' chore that is due or past due.

2. Click 'Export' to export this report to a .CSV file
3. Open the .CSV file in Microsoft Excel and remove the first row. (Headers)
4. Save the .CSV file
5. Load the .CSV file into Hoof Supervisor



All Animals Hoof Trim Report

This report contains all animals on the farm. If you would like to specify animals by DIM, DCC, AGE, etc you must add a filter to the report.

2. Click 'Export' to export this report to a .CSV file
3. Open the .CSV file in Microsoft Excel and remove the first row. (Headers)
4. Save the .CSV file
3. Load the .CSV file into Hoof Supervisor



Remove Headers & Save File:

1. Select row 1 (Headers)
2. Right Click > Delete (If prompted, Shift Cells Up)
3. File > Save




Hoof Supervisor Codes
A– Abscess (White line)
C– Corkscrew claw
  • D– Digital Dermatitis (often paired with an M-stage scoring system)
  • E– Heel erosion
  • F– Foot rot
  • H– Sole Hemorrhage
  • I– Interdigital dermatitis
  • K– Interdigital fibroma / Corn
  • L– Laminitis
  • N– Non-foot lameness (injuries outside of the hoof)
  • S– White line separation
  • T– Toe ulcer
  • U– Sole ulcer
  • W– Thin sole / White line fissure
